NC State's Donavan Phillip, Stanford's Jasmine Aikey win Hermann Trophy
Forwards Donavan Phillip of NC State and Jasmine Aikey of Stanford have been voted Hermann Trophy winners as the top college soccer players.
Late goal lifts Florida State to Women's College Cup title over Stanford
Florida State clinched the Women's College Cup with a 1-0 defeat of Stanford on Monday night, thanks to a late goal by Wrianna Hudson.
